Short version
PayCheck is a privacy-first Android app for personal finance tracking. Your financial data stays on your device: we do not send transactions, amounts, accounts, categories, goals, notes or financial analytics to our servers.

Financial data stored locally
PayCheck may store the following locally on your device: transactions, amounts, accounts, categories, goals, notes, financial analytics, display settings, local export/import files and local backup files.
We do not have access to this data and do not synchronize your financial history with our server. This data may leave your device only if you export it, create a backup, send a file through a third-party service, or explicitly include financial information in a support request or bug report.
App technical data, account and Premium
If you sign in, join the beta program or use Premium, we may process technical and account data: Supabase user id, email, username, name or display name, avatar URL, language, currency, theme, technical settings, Premium status and subscription expiration. For Premium through Google Play, this may also include technical purchase metadata, such as purchase token and product id, provided by Google Play to confirm and synchronize Premium access.
This data is used for sign-in, account security, Premium access, user support and beta program administration. It does not contain your local financial history or payment details.
Data the app receives from vados.dev
The app may contact vados.dev to receive public or technical data: exchange rates, posts/news, beta status, APK metadata, account settings or support responses. These requests may create server logs containing IP address, User-Agent, timestamp and request path.
These requests do not transmit your local transactions, amounts, accounts, categories, goals, notes or financial analytics to us.
Export, import and backups
Manual export/import and Premium scheduled local backups are user-controlled local operations. If you choose to save an export or backup to cloud storage, a messenger, email, file manager or another service, that file is handled by the service you choose.
Premium scheduled local backup is created on your device or in the local storage location you choose. It does not mean hidden upload of financial data to cloud storage or to our server.
Google AdMob advertising
The Free version of PayCheck may show ads through Google AdMob / Google Mobile Ads SDK. Google and its advertising partners may process advertising ID, device identifiers, IP address, approximate location, ad interaction data, diagnostics and other technical data for ad delivery, fraud prevention, measurement and, depending on your settings and consent, ad personalization.
We do not send your transactions, amounts, accounts, categories, goals, notes or financial analytics to AdMob and do not use financial history for advertising.
Google Play payments and subscriptions
Premium is subscribed to and paid for through Google Play Billing. Google Play processes payment data, taxes, payment methods, cancellations and renewals. We do not receive your full card number or bank details.
If you subscribe to Premium, the app may receive technical purchase data from Google Play, such as purchase token, product id, subscription status, expiration date and related user id. This is used only to confirm Premium access in the app after sign-in or reinstall.
Beta program, support and bug reports
In the beta program and support flows, we may process email, username, name, application status, selected testing directions, IP address, User-Agent, language, approximate country/city based on IP, device information, app version, Android version, messages, replies, bug reports, screenshots, attachments and logs that you submit.
Please do not include full financial data in bug reports or support requests unless it is necessary to resolve the issue. If you do include such data, we process it only for support and bug fixing.
Data from PayCheck pages on vados.dev
When you visit PayCheck or beta program pages on vados.dev, we may process server logs and technical data: IP address, User-Agent, device type, page, referrer, request time, cookie/session data, beta account sign-in data, form data, analytics events and security logs.
PayCheck pages may use PostHog or similar analytics when configured, and our own logs for security, statistics, attack detection and service operation.

What we do not do
We do not sell financial data. We do not read your local transactions. We do not store PayCheck financial history on our server. We do not use financial data for advertising. We do not access your bank accounts, cards or full payment credentials.
Purposes of processing
We process data to operate the website and app; provide sign-in and account security; run the beta program; respond to support requests; process bug reports; show ads in the Free version; enable Premium access through Google Play if you subscribe; provide exchange rates and technical configuration; prevent abuse, attacks and fraud; run website analytics; and comply with legal or accounting obligations.
Retention and deletion
Local financial data stays on your device until you delete it in the app or delete the app/app data.
Technical account, Premium, beta, support, email and security log data is retained as long as needed for service operation, support, security, subscription handling, legal obligations or dispute resolution. PayCheck account data can be deleted through /en/paycheck/account-deletion using your account email and 12-character PayCheck ID. Some records may be retained longer when required for security, audit, legal compliance or abuse prevention.
